Slow Oscillatory Transcranial Direct Current Stimulation for Refractory Focal Epilepsy

NCT07684352 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 10

Last updated 2026-07-06

No results posted yet for this study

Summary

This pilot study evaluated whether a type of non-invasive brain stimulation called slow-oscillatory transcranial direct current stimulation (so-tDCS) can reduce seizure frequency in patients with drug-resistant focal epilepsy. Ten patients received 14 days of so-tDCS (2 mA, 1 Hz) for 20 minutes twice daily, guided by their individual seizure focus identified by EEG and MRI. Seizure frequency and epileptiform discharges were measured before, during, and up to 8 weeks after treatment. The study also assessed safety and tolerability. Results showed that so-tDCS significantly reduced seizure frequency, with the greatest effect occurring during the first week of treatment, and the benefit was sustained during follow-up. No serious adverse events were reported. These preliminary findings suggest that so-tDCS may be a safe and effective non-invasive option for refractory focal epilepsy, but larger sham-controlled trials are needed to confirm efficacy.

Interventions

DEVICE

Slow-oscillatory transcranial direct current stimulation (so-tDCS)

1 Hz sinusoidal oscillatory current, 2 mA peak-to-peak, delivered via sponge electrodes (13.68 cm²) soaked in 0.9% saline. Cathode placed over individual epileptogenic zone (defined by MRI, FDG-PET, MEG, and scalp EEG). Reference anode placed at FP1 or FP2 (contralateral). Each session: 20 minutes with 20-second ramp-up/ramp-down. Two sessions per day, separated by a 20-minute rest period, for 14 consecutive days.
